Chocolate brown precipitate is formed with:

A

`Cu^(2+)` ions and `[Fe (CN)_(6)]^(3-)`

B

`Cu^(2+)` ions and `[Fe (CN)_(6)]^(4-)`

C

`Fe^(2+)` ions and `[Fe (CN)_(6)]^(4-)`

D

`Fe^(2+)` ions and dimethylglyoxime

Text Solution

AI Generated Solution

The correct Answer is:
To determine which compound forms a chocolate brown precipitate, we will analyze the provided options step by step. ### Step-by-Step Solution: 1. **Identify the Options:** - Option A: Cu²⁺ ions and Fe(CN)₆³⁻ - Option B: Cu²⁺ ions and Fe(CN)₆⁴⁻ - Option C: Fe²⁺ ions and Fe(CN)₆⁴⁻ - Option D: Fe²⁺ ions and dimethylglyoxime 2. **Analyze Option A:** - When Cu²⁺ ions react with Fe(CN)₆³⁻, the product formed is Cu₃[Fe(CN)₆]₂. - The precipitate formed is green in color. - **Conclusion:** Option A does not produce a chocolate brown precipitate. 3. **Analyze Option B:** - When Cu²⁺ ions react with Fe(CN)₆⁴⁻, the product formed is Cu₂[Fe(CN)₆]. - The precipitate formed is chocolate brown in color. - **Conclusion:** Option B produces a chocolate brown precipitate. 4. **Analyze Option C:** - When Fe²⁺ ions react with Fe(CN)₆⁴⁻, the product formed is Fe₃[Fe(CN)₆]₂. - The precipitate formed is blue in color. - **Conclusion:** Option C does not produce a chocolate brown precipitate. 5. **Analyze Option D:** - When Fe²⁺ ions react with dimethylglyoxime, the product formed is a red precipitate. - **Conclusion:** Option D does not produce a chocolate brown precipitate. ### Final Conclusion: The only option that produces a chocolate brown precipitate is **Option B: Cu²⁺ ions and Fe(CN)₆⁴⁻**. ---
